Description
A beautifully detailed c. 1730 J. B. Homann map of Spain and Portugal. Depicts the Iberian peninsula in considerable detail including the Balearic Islands of Majorca, Minorca and Ibiza. Also covers parts of France and northern Africa. The map notes fortified cities, villages, roads, bridges, forests, castles and topography. Elaborate title cartouche in the upper right quadrant features two mermen supporting a wreath and 15 armorial crests, 14 crests for the various regions of Spain in addition to one more depicting the Spanish royal arms. Map scales in lower left quadrant. Alternative title in Spanish in top margin, El Reyno de Espanna dividido en dos grandes Estados de Argon Y de Castilla, subdividido en muchas Provincias, donde le halla tambien El Reyno de Portugal. This map was drawn in Nuremberg by J. B. Homann and included in the Homann Heirs Maior Atlas Scholasticus ex Triginta Sex Generalibus et Specialibus…. .
